氯碱主业承压 中泰化学上半年亏损1.94亿元
Core Viewpoint - Zhongtai Chemical has reported continuous losses for three consecutive years, with significant declines in both revenue and net profit, primarily due to a challenging market environment in the chlor-alkali industry and its textile business [1][2]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Zhongtai Chemical achieved operating revenue of 13.955 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 8.32% [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of 194 million yuan, an improvement from a loss of 243 million yuan in the same period last year [2]. - For the full year of 2023, the company reported an operating revenue of 37.118 billion yuan, down 28.15%, and a net loss of 2.865 billion yuan [2]. - In 2024, operating revenue further declined to 30.123 billion yuan, a decrease of 18.84%, with a net loss of 977 million yuan [2]. Industry Context - The chlor-alkali industry is experiencing low overall market conditions, with significant price declines in PVC products impacting Zhongtai Chemical's performance [3][4]. - The price of liquid caustic soda fell dramatically from 3,000 yuan per ton in Q4 2024 to 852 yuan per ton by August 2025, leading to reduced profit margins for companies in the sector [3]. - The PVC powder market has shown a downward trend, with the average price for SG-5 (PVC powder) at 4,939 yuan per ton in the first half of 2025, down 11.23% year-on-year [3]. Regulatory Issues - Zhongtai Chemical faced penalties for information disclosure violations, including financial fraud, leading to a fine of 5 million yuan and a warning from regulatory authorities [6][7]. - The company was found to have engaged in non-operating fund occupation transactions totaling 7.718 billion yuan between 2021 and 2022, significantly impacting its financial reporting [6].

Core Viewpoint - Coty Inc. experienced a significant stock decline, dropping nearly 23% to a new low since November 2020, following the release of its Q4 fiscal year 2025 earnings report, which showed a revenue decrease despite beating analyst expectations [1] Financial Performance - Revenue for Q4 FY2025 decreased by 8% year-over-year to $1.25 billion, surpassing analyst expectations of $1.21 billion [1] - Net loss narrowed from $96.9 million in the same quarter last year to $68.8 million [1] - Adjusted earnings per share showed a loss of $0.05, while analysts had anticipated a profit of $0.01 per share [1] Challenges Faced - The company faced multiple challenges during the recent fiscal year, including a weak U.S. market, inventory destocking by retailers, and consumers seeking value [1]

长城电工股价下跌3.5% 半年度亏损同比扩大38.5%
Jin Rong Jie· 2025-08-15 21:00
Core Viewpoint - The company, Changcheng Electric, reported a decline in revenue and an increase in net loss for the first half of 2025, indicating financial challenges ahead [1]. Financial Performance - For the first half of 2025, the company achieved an operating revenue of 694 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 6.31% [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was -112 million yuan, with a year-on-year loss increase of 38.51% [1]. - The company's asset-liability ratio reached 76.64%, up 4.71 percentage points compared to the same period last year [1]. Market Activity - As of August 15, 2025, the stock price of Changcheng Electric was 11.30 yuan, down 3.5% from the previous trading day [1]. - The trading volume on that day was 631,093 hands, with a transaction amount of 708 million yuan, resulting in a turnover rate of 14.29% [1]. - On August 15, there was a net outflow of main funds amounting to 23.21 million yuan, with a cumulative net outflow of 109 million yuan over the past five days [1]. Company Overview - Changcheng Electric operates in the electrical machinery and equipment manufacturing industry, with products including medium and high voltage switchgear, bus ducts, and power electronic devices [1]. - The actual controller of the company is the Gansu Provincial State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ission, indicating it is a local state-owned enterprise [1].
